COleDropTarget::OnDrop

Virtual BOOL OnDrop ( CWnd * pWnd, COleDataObject * pDataObject, DROPEFFECT dropEffect, CPoint punto );

Valore restituito

Diverso da zero se il calo è successo; in caso contrario 0.

Parametri

pWnd

Punti alla finestra che il cursore è attualmente posizionato.

pDataObject

Punti all'oggetto dati che contiene i dati per essere lasciato cadere.

dropEffect

L'effetto che l'utente ha scelto per l'operazione di goccia. Può essere uno o più dei seguenti:

punto

Contiene la posizione del cursore, in pixel, rispetto allo schermo.

Osservazioni

Viene chiamato dal framework quando un funzionamento goccia è a verificarsi. Il framework chiama innanzitutto OnDropEx. Se la funzione OnDropEx non consente di gestire la goccia, il framework chiama questa funzione membro, OnDrop. In genere, l'applicazione esegue l'override OnDropEx nella classe di visualizzazione per gestire il pulsante destro del mouse- trascinamento della selezione. In genere, la classe di visualizzazione OnDrop viene utilizzata per gestire drop e semplice drag.

L'implementazione predefinita di COleDropTarget::OnDrop chiama CView::OnDrop, che semplicemente restituisce FALSE per impostazione predefinita.

Per ulteriori informazioni, vedere IDropTarget::Drop in OLE 2 Programmer di riferimento, Volume 1.

COleDropTarget pa&noramica |nbsp; Membri della classe | Gerarchia Chart

Vedere a&nchenbsp;COleDropTarget::OnDragOver, COleDropTarget::OnDragEnter, COleDropTarget::OnDropEx

Index